Warton, a charming village steeped in history, is the perfect base for holidaymakers exploring nearby Carnforth, Silverdale, and the stunning Arnside and Silverdale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ty (AONB). Warton Crag, a nature reserve, offers scenic walks and panoramic views across Morecambe Bay.
History lovers can visit St. Oswald’s Church and Warton Old Rectory, a 14th-century ruin linked to George Washington’s ancestors. Silverdale, a short drive away, is a haven for nature enthusiasts with its peaceful woodlands, limestone pavements, and abundant wildlife. Don’t miss Leighton Moss RSPB Reserve, renowned for birdwatching and home to species like marsh harriers.

Silverdale offers serene coastal walks with stunning views. Carnforth, within 5 minutes’ drive from Warton, is famous for its iconic railway station, featured in the classic film Brief Encounter. The station houses a small heritage centre and a tearoom. Carnforth also offers local shops, supermarkets, pubs, and easy access to the nearby Lancaster Canal for peaceful walks or cycling.
Warton is also conveniently close to the Lake District, with Windermere and the southern lakes just a 30-minute drive away. This makes it easy to enjoy the beauty of the Lakes while returning to the tranquillity of Warton. With stunning landscapes, rich wildlife, and easy access to both coast and countryside, Warton is an ideal holiday destination. Beach 5 miles
